The garden at St. Peter and St. Mary’s church is located in the beautiful Baker historic district. Produce from the garden is used to provide meals to the homeless.

We have had many salads, vegetable, and squash dishes to serve our homeless population at our Tuesday  night dinners. The Joy of these people eating this fresh produce is awesome.

Individuals such as Daryl come to the church daily where he tends to his own garden plot on the corner and helps with watering other plots. This garden gives the neighborhood life and also gives him a worthwhile purpose. An herb project was also started this year successfully  adding flavor to our soups and stews and to dry for use over the winter.
